Dual Electrostatic Super Tweeter

Powered by the cutting-edging miniature electrostatic tweeter technology, It employs a six micro gram, gold plated membrane held against a plate charged up to 400 volts. The electrical signal voltage is amplified up to 100 times via a built-in miniature transformer. The electrostatic attraction and repulsion effects induced by music signal triggers the membrane to produce acoustic pressure. Simply plug into your player and high fidelity music is ready to go.

What is POLA

‘‘A design that truly brings out the ES driver’s qualities’’

The first thing that comes to our mind when the latest Sonion ES-driver consisting of fancy micro step-up transformers are sent to us in early 2018?

It is not about achieving higher specs, but rather what we can do to utilize the design for a higher level of perceived enjoyment and a more immersive experience in listening!

POLA - the end result after a year worth of product research, houses a large and fast 13MM Graphene (carbon allotrope)  dynamic driver driving a lot of air, implemented to pair with the latest ES driver quite alike traditional speakers with a super tweeter.

Now you can hear very deep and layered bass, charming and full-bodied vocal and even fine details in the ambiance thanks to the new tweeter innovation and synergy of the design.

Design Story

The original POLA is displayed at Canjams in Early 2018, earliest prototype is a 3D metal printed universal housing featuring a smaller diameter dynamic driver with the electrostatic drivers. The sound is very well received however together with AAW we hope to push the design to its limits. During 2018 we have tried to put prototypes with BA, multi hybrid designs at show and private gatherings for feedbacks, and in the end we are answering with the current design that houses not only specifications that goes up the roof, but concrete driver implementations allowing the design to scale up with sources and reflects the mastering’s quality. At just 16ohms POLA will work with most phones and laptops, and quality DAPs or Amplifiers supplying better power, also well mastered tracks will definitely boost performance to a more enjoyable tier!

The AAW Vantage

CUSTOM FITMENT
AAW achieves exceptional comfort in custom in-ear monitors by using advanced 3D scanning and editing technology. Each customer's ear impressions are digitally scanned to create precise 3D models, which are then optimized for a secure, ergonomic fit. This process ensures CIEMs conform seamlessly to the ear’s contours, delivering unmatched comfort and sound isolation for superior acoustic performance.
IMPECCABLE UNIVERSAL FITMENT
AAW leverages a vast database of thousands of ear impressions collected over the years to design universal-fit in-ear monitors (IEMs) that emulate the comfort and seal of custom-fit models. By analyzing ear anatomy patterns and using advanced 3D modeling and manufacturing techniques, AAW creates ergonomic shells that fit a wide range of ear shapes. Rigorous user testing ensures a secure fit, optimal comfort, and superior acoustic performance, delivering a near-custom experience for audiophiles and professionals alike.
SKIN SAFE MATERIAL
AAW's UIEMs and CIEMs are meticulously crafted using medical-grade resin or PVD aluminum, offering a dense, impact-resistant housing for exceptional durability. The skin-friendly resin is further enhanced with an anti-bacterial lacquer, ensuring added protection and irritation-free comfort.
